Bronx smash-and-grab nets over $2M in diamond jewelry
MYPost ^ | Aug 7, 2022

Posted on 08/07/2022 4:24:23 PM PDT by Conservat1

A classic smash-and-grab heist in the Bronx netted a clutch of thieves more $2.15 million in “high end diamond jewelry” during a wild, caught-on-video robbery on Friday, police said.
